Mailbox, telegraph line and telephone, designed by Danish artist Finn Andersen (1909-1987), printed by lithogravure, and issued by Denmark on June 19, 1986 to publicize the 19th European Congress of the Postal, Telegraph and Telephone International organization, held in Copenhagen, August 12-16, Scott No. 822, Facit No. 903.

This is my main collecting theme after printing. I am in the process of producing a handbook covering every (hopefully!) letter box stamp, MS, stamp booklet, postmark, stationery item, Cinderella, etc. A mammoth undertaking, as there are many hundreds of stamps, let alone the other collectables.

Anyway, I attach the latest such stamp issue, which is from the Bailiwick of Guernsey, in the Channel Islands. It commemorates the sporting achievements by Carl Hester in the equestrian events, especially at the London 2012 Olympics. I suspect that Guernsey Post fought shy of including the word "Olympics" on the stamp due to the cost of paying the IOC for the use of the word.

Incidentally, every winner from Team GB has a pillar box painted gold in perpetuity, and commemorative plaques are in the process of being affixed to each box. The wording is also in Braille on the plaque.

Birds mailing letters, printed by photogravure, and issued by Great Britain on November 16, 1983 for Christmas, Scott No. 1035.

Here is an image of a stamp depicting a girl mailing a letter, designed after a child's drawing, printed by photogravure, and issued by Japan on April 20, 1971 as one of a set of three stamps commemorating the centenary of Japanese postage stamps, Scott No. 1058.

Postman emptying a mailbox, printed by photogravure, and issued by Hungary on June 25, 1955 as one of a series of stamps depicting various occupations, designed by Zoltán Nagy and József Vertel, Scott No. 1123.
